Join award-winning author Kim Ventrella for a breakdown of the traditional publishing process, from finding an agent and selling your book, to seeing your work on bookstore shelves.

Class experience

Students will become knowledgeable about the traditional publishing process. Students will learn the difference between traditional publishing, self-publishing, and vanity presses.
Kim Ventrella is the award-winning author of four middle grade novels, including THE SECRET LIFE OF SAM (HarperCollins), a 2021 Oklahoma Book Award winner and one of Kirkus Reviews' Best Books of 2020. Her novel BONE HOLLOW (Scholastic) was chosen as a 2019 Best Book for Kids by the New York Public Library, and SKELETON TREE was nominated for the 2019 Carnegie Medal in the UK. Her short fiction has appeared in the anthology DON'T TURN OUT THE LIGHTS. She is represented by Alec Shane of Writers House. In addition to her writing, she is an experienced editor, teacher, and speaker.
